This Christmas, Six Senses Krabey Island celebrates the toddy palm tree. Known as the Tnaot in Khmer, it is Cambodia’s treasured national tree. A symbol of life, resilience, and community, the palm has long been called the “Tree of Life.” Every part gives back. In sugar and juice, in shelter and handicrafts, it embodies abundance and togetherness, the essence of Khmer culture. Christmas morning at Six Senses Fiji begins with the voices of Solevu Village’s Sunday School Choir. Their Fijian carols include local versions of time-honored classics sung harmoniously in island style, filling the resort with warmth and melody. Afterward, the children join Santa and our hosts for lunch at RaRa Restaurant, sharing gifts and laughter. This cherished tradition strengthens ties between guests, hosts, and the local community, embodying Fiji’s Bula spirit of joy and generosity.
At Six Senses Yao Noi, each arrival becomes an act of connection through the traditional Thai Spirit House welcome ritual. Guided by your GEM beneath a centuries-old banyan tree, you’ll offer incense, make a wish, and receive a blessing for health and happiness in the form of a white sai sin bracelet. You’re invited to participate in a living tradition that honors the guardians of Koh Yao Noi. The ritual is playful yet profound, turning a check-in into a soulful welcome and introduction to Thai culture, weaving joy and gratitude into your stay and setting you up for serenity in 2026 and beyond.
